(MUNICIPALITY OF WEST PERTH, ON) On Tuesday October 16, 2012, Perth County OPP officers in Mitchell received a call regarding graffiti on the West Perth Dam in Mitchell. A business owner in the Mitchell downtown also reported the appearance of graffiti on his business. The ink graffiti has appeared between Saturday October 13th and Tuesday October 16th.
The public is reminded that Graffiti wilfully damages or destroys property. It is therefore the Criminal Code offence of mischief, and those convicted of this offence can be punished with a prison sentence for up to 10 years.
Graffiti affects all of us and is not a victimless crime. It can leave the impression that no one cares, can lead to increased graffiti and crime, could cause a loss of business growth and tourism and the clean up can divert tax dollars from community programs and services.
